New Zealand’s methane bill sparks global criticism for weakening climate goals by favoring dairy over science.
New Zealand’s government faces international backlash for passing a methane emissions bill that Greenpeace and climate scientists say undermines climate goals by relying on the discredited “no additional warming” approach.
The legislation, introduced without public consultation, prioritizes the dairy industry and has triggered a potential EU trade investigation and a “Fossil of the Day” award at a UN climate conference.
Critics warn the move risks encouraging other nations to delay emissions cuts and threatens global climate efforts.
